Summary
We are looking for a detail-oriented Staff Accountant to perform accounting duties within our organization. The Staff Accountants responsibilities include maintaining financial records and reports performing account reconciliations assisting with budget and closing processes assisting with internal audits and maintaining GL accounts documentation. You will also be assisting the Analyst as needed and respond to information requests by management and for auditing purposes.
To be successful as staff accountant you should be able to accurately maintain a general ledger and ensure compliance with generally accepted accounting principles (GAAP). An outstanding staff accountant should also have excellent communication organizational and analytical skills.

HOW YOU WILL CONTRIBUTE
- Maintaining financial reports records and general ledger accounts
- Preparing journal entries analyses and account reconciliations and assisting with monthly close processes
- Contributing to the development and review of annual operating budgets and performance projections
- Performing monthly balance sheet reconciliations
- Meeting processing and reporting deadlines
- Responding to information requests reviewing financial statements and assisting with audits
- Ensuring compliance with GAAP
- Assisting the analyst as needed
WHO YOU ARE
- Bachelors degree in accounting or finance
- Strong communication skills and the ability to collaborate with staff members
- Strong organizational and stress management skills
- Ability to manage deadlines and work in a high-pressure environment
- Working knowledge of GAAP
- Knowledge of SAP
- Strong numeracy and analytical skills
- Good problem-solving and time management skills
- Highly organized and detail-oriented
Salary: $70000 - $78000 per year plus incentives
Health benefits include: Medical and prescription drug insurance dental insurance vision insurance critical illness insurance accident insurance hospital indemnity insurance personalized healthcare support wellbeing programs.
Financial benefits include: Health Savings Account (HSA) Flexible Spending Accounts (FSAs) 401(k) plan basic life and AD&D insurance and short-term disability insurance.
